[][src]Enum pgx::PgBuiltInOids

pub enum PgBuiltInOids {
    BOOLOID,
    BYTEAOID,
    CHAROID,
    NAMEOID,
    INT8OID,
    INT2OID,
    INT2VECTOROID,
    INT4OID,
    REGPROCOID,
    TEXTOID,
    OIDOID,
    TIDOID,
    XIDOID,
    CIDOID,
    OIDVECTOROID,
    JSONOID,
    XMLOID,
    PGNODETREEOID,
    PGNDISTINCTOID,
    PGDEPENDENCIESOID,
    PGDDLCOMMANDOID,
    POINTOID,
    LSEGOID,
    PATHOID,
    BOXOID,
    POLYGONOID,
    LINEOID,
    FLOAT4OID,
    FLOAT8OID,
    UNKNOWNOID,
    CIRCLEOID,
    CASHOID,
    MACADDROID,
    INETOID,
    CIDROID,
    MACADDR8OID,
    INT2ARRAYOID,
    INT4ARRAYOID,
    TEXTARRAYOID,
    OIDARRAYOID,
    FLOAT4ARRAYOID,
    ACLITEMOID,
    CSTRINGARRAYOID,
    BPCHAROID,
    VARCHAROID,
    DATEOID,
    TIMEOID,
    TIMESTAMPOID,
    TIMESTAMPTZOID,
    INTERVALOID,
    TIMETZOID,
    BITOID,
    VARBITOID,
    NUMERICOID,
    REFCURSOROID,
    REGPROCEDUREOID,
    REGOPEROID,
    REGOPERATOROID,
    REGCLASSOID,
    REGTYPEOID,
    REGROLEOID,
    REGNAMESPACEOID,
    REGTYPEARRAYOID,
    UUIDOID,
    LSNOID,
    TSVECTOROID,
    GTSVECTOROID,
    TSQUERYOID,
    REGCONFIGOID,
    REGDICTIONARYOID,
    JSONBOID,
    INT4RANGEOID,
    RECORDOID,
    RECORDARRAYOID,
    CSTRINGOID,
    ANYOID,
    ANYARRAYOID,
    VOIDOID,
    TRIGGEROID,
    EVTTRIGGEROID,
    LANGUAGE_HANDLEROID,
    INTERNALOID,
    OPAQUEOID,
    ANYELEMENTOID,
    ANYNONARRAYOID,
    ANYENUMOID,
    FDW_HANDLEROID,
    INDEX_AM_HANDLEROID,
    TSM_HANDLEROID,
    ANYRANGEOID,
    ABSTIMEOID,
    RELTIMEOID,
    TINTERVALOID,
    XMLARRAYOID,
    TSVECTORARRAYOID,
    GTSVECTORARRAYOID,
    TSQUERYARRAYOID,
    REGCONFIGARRAYOID,
    REGDICTIONARYARRAYOID,
    JSONBARRAYOID,
    TXID_SNAPSHOTOID,
    TXID_SNAPSHOTARRAYOID,
    INT4RANGEARRAYOID,
    NUMRANGEOID,
    NUMRANGEARRAYOID,
    TSRANGEOID,
    TSRANGEARRAYOID,
    TSTZRANGEOID,
    TSTZRANGEARRAYOID,
    DATERANGEOID,
    DATERANGEARRAYOID,
    INT8RANGEOID,
    INT8RANGEARRAYOID,
    JSONARRAYOID,
    SMGROID,
    LINEARRAYOID,
    CIRCLEARRAYOID,
    MONEYARRAYOID,
    BOOLARRAYOID,
    BYTEAARRAYOID,
    CHARARRAYOID,
    NAMEARRAYOID,
    INT2VECTORARRAYOID,
    REGPROCARRAYOID,
    TIDARRAYOID,
    XIDARRAYOID,
    CIDARRAYOID,
    OIDVECTORARRAYOID,
    BPCHARARRAYOID,
    VARCHARARRAYOID,
    INT8ARRAYOID,
    POINTARRAYOID,
    LSEGARRAYOID,
    PATHARRAYOID,
    BOXARRAYOID,
    FLOAT8ARRAYOID,
    ABSTIMEARRAYOID,
    RELTIMEARRAYOID,
    TINTERVALARRAYOID,
    POLYGONARRAYOID,
    ACLITEMARRAYOID,
    MACADDRARRAYOID,
    MACADDR8ARRAYOID,
    INETARRAYOID,
    CIDRARRAYOID,
    TIMESTAMPARRAYOID,
    DATEARRAYOID,
    TIMEARRAYOID,
    REFCURSORARRAYOID,
    VARBITARRAYOID,
    BITARRAYOID,
    TIMETZARRAYOID,
    TIMESTAMPTZARRAYOID,
    INTERVALARRAYOID,
    NUMERICARRAYOID,
    UUIDARRAYOID,
    REGPROCEDUREARRAYOID,
    REGOPERARRAYOID,
    REGOPERATORARRAYOID,
    REGCLASSARRAYOID,
    REGROLEARRAYOID,
    REGNAMESPACEARRAYOID,
    PG_LSNARRAYOID,
}

Variants

BOOLOID
BYTEAOID
CHAROID
NAMEOID
INT8OID
INT2OID
INT2VECTOROID
INT4OID
REGPROCOID
TEXTOID
OIDOID
TIDOID
XIDOID
CIDOID
OIDVECTOROID
JSONOID
XMLOID
PGNODETREEOID
PGNDISTINCTOID
PGDEPENDENCIESOID
PGDDLCOMMANDOID
POINTOID
LSEGOID
PATHOID
BOXOID
POLYGONOID
LINEOID
FLOAT4OID
FLOAT8OID
UNKNOWNOID
CIRCLEOID
CASHOID
MACADDROID
INETOID
CIDROID
MACADDR8OID
INT2ARRAYOID
INT4ARRAYOID
TEXTARRAYOID
OIDARRAYOID
FLOAT4ARRAYOID
ACLITEMOID
CSTRINGARRAYOID
BPCHAROID
VARCHAROID
DATEOID
TIMEOID
TIMESTAMPOID
TIMESTAMPTZOID
INTERVALOID
TIMETZOID
BITOID
VARBITOID
NUMERICOID
REFCURSOROID
REGPROCEDUREOID
REGOPEROID
REGOPERATOROID
REGCLASSOID
REGTYPEOID
REGROLEOID
REGNAMESPACEOID
REGTYPEARRAYOID
UUIDOID
LSNOID
TSVECTOROID
GTSVECTOROID
TSQUERYOID
REGCONFIGOID
REGDICTIONARYOID
JSONBOID
INT4RANGEOID
RECORDOID
RECORDARRAYOID
CSTRINGOID
ANYOID
ANYARRAYOID
VOIDOID
TRIGGEROID
EVTTRIGGEROID
LANGUAGE_HANDLEROID
INTERNALOID
OPAQUEOID
ANYELEMENTOID
ANYNONARRAYOID
ANYENUMOID
FDW_HANDLEROID
INDEX_AM_HANDLEROID
TSM_HANDLEROID
ANYRANGEOID
ABSTIMEOID
RELTIMEOID
TINTERVALOID
XMLARRAYOID
TSVECTORARRAYOID
GTSVECTORARRAYOID
TSQUERYARRAYOID
REGCONFIGARRAYOID
REGDICTIONARYARRAYOID
JSONBARRAYOID
TXID_SNAPSHOTOID
TXID_SNAPSHOTARRAYOID
INT4RANGEARRAYOID
NUMRANGEOID
NUMRANGEARRAYOID
TSRANGEOID
TSRANGEARRAYOID
TSTZRANGEOID
TSTZRANGEARRAYOID
DATERANGEOID
DATERANGEARRAYOID
INT8RANGEOID
INT8RANGEARRAYOID
JSONARRAYOID
SMGROID
LINEARRAYOID
CIRCLEARRAYOID
MONEYARRAYOID
BOOLARRAYOID
BYTEAARRAYOID
CHARARRAYOID
NAMEARRAYOID
INT2VECTORARRAYOID
REGPROCARRAYOID
TIDARRAYOID
XIDARRAYOID
CIDARRAYOID
OIDVECTORARRAYOID
BPCHARARRAYOID
VARCHARARRAYOID
INT8ARRAYOID
POINTARRAYOID
LSEGARRAYOID
PATHARRAYOID
BOXARRAYOID
FLOAT8ARRAYOID
ABSTIMEARRAYOID
RELTIMEARRAYOID
TINTERVALARRAYOID
POLYGONARRAYOID
ACLITEMARRAYOID
MACADDRARRAYOID
MACADDR8ARRAYOID
INETARRAYOID
CIDRARRAYOID
TIMESTAMPARRAYOID
DATEARRAYOID
TIMEARRAYOID
REFCURSORARRAYOID
VARBITARRAYOID
BITARRAYOID
TIMETZARRAYOID
TIMESTAMPTZARRAYOID
INTERVALARRAYOID
NUMERICARRAYOID
UUIDARRAYOID
REGPROCEDUREARRAYOID
REGOPERARRAYOID
REGOPERATORARRAYOID
REGCLASSARRAYOID
REGROLEARRAYOID
REGNAMESPACEARRAYOID
PG_LSNARRAYOID

Implementations

impl PgBuiltInOids[src]

pub fn value(self) -> u32[src]

pub fn oid(self) -> PgOid[src]

Trait Implementations

impl Clone for PgBuiltInOids[src]

impl Copy for PgBuiltInOids[src]

impl Debug for PgBuiltInOids[src]

impl Eq for PgBuiltInOids[src]

impl Hash for PgBuiltInOids[src]

impl Ord for PgBuiltInOids[src]

impl PartialEq<PgBuiltInOids> for PgBuiltInOids[src]

impl PartialOrd<PgBuiltInOids> for PgBuiltInOids[src]

Auto Trait Implementations

Blanket Implementations

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> From<T> for T[src]

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T> Sealed<T> for T where
    T: ?Sized

impl<T> ToOwned for T where
    T: Clone
[src]

type Owned = T

The resulting type after obtaining ownership.

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.